Make your own watering can.

April 21, 2013 by not your average mom 2 Comments

Today we made watering cans.

It was pretty easy.

Here’s what you need:

  • a milk jug (make sure it has a screw on top) or small laundry detergent container
  • a drill (you could probably use a hammer and a nail if you don’t have a drill)
  • paint, if you want to decorate your watering can

Here’s what you need to do:

1.  Wash out the container. 

DSC00308

2. Drill holes in the top. Turn it over first and drill from the inside.

DSC00324

3. Decorate your jug if  you want.

DSC00309

4. Drill a couple holes in the back, otherwise the water won’t pour out easily.

DSC00331

5. Voila! Happy Watering!
